Chatnahalli in context

With 1,157 people at the 2011 Census, Chatnahalli was the 243rd most populous of its district's 2574 villages, above the district average of 544.

The sex ratio was 1009 women per 1,000 men (level with the district's rural figure of 1012) — one of the minority of villages where women outnumbered men. Among children aged 0–6 the ratio was 1109, 186 above the rural national 923.

36.7% of the population were recorded as workers, 17.8 points below the district's rural rate.
